Our Commitment

At PEP, we’re committed to diversity on all levels; it’s our key to success. To achieve our goals as a company, we must reflect diversity in all aspects of our work. By utilizing our diverse workforce, we gain the competitive advantage needed to succeed in the marketplace.

As a certified Minority Business Enterprise (MBE), we know that diversity is about more than just race and gender. We value diversity in backgrounds, education, customers, suppliers, and communities. Our daily commitment to diversity and inclusion helps us attract quality candidates, clients, and suppliers. Because at PEP, diversity isn’t optional, it’s essential.

PEP demonstrates its commitment to diversity through the following:

• National Minority Supplier Diversity Council (NMSDC) certification
• South Central Ohio Minority Business Council (SCOMBC) certification
• Community activities in Cincinnati and Boston areas
